Thoughts on doing a GT3RS paint scheme on my 03 Boxster S....
 
I really like the look of the GT3 RS paint scheme. Obviously they look perfectly in place on the GT3 or GT3 RS. I am wondering how this scheme would look on a Boxster. I would love to add either the green accents like this car below or Riviera Blue. I was thinking I would paint the wheels to match, and get the script along the side and possibly the mirrors painted. This will be a track/DE car but also driven on the street on a regular basis. Yay or Nay?

I really had to think about the gold wheel treatment with my black on sand beige, but in the end, I wanted "Get the hell out of my way" not "look at me."

Think about a black cherry stripe at the natural highlight going from behind the headlight to the taillight on the upper side of the car. The black cherry is a flip flop style paint that comes and goes with the direction of lighting. Now it's here.........now it's not.
